"Working as a creative allows us to enter the world of the unknown, creating our visions on a blank canvas." - Neil Dorward.

Neil Dorward is a director & producer from London England.

Now based in Los Angeles Neil travels worldwide to work on various creative projects.

Most recently opening smash hit show "The Illusionists" in New York on Broadway.